Most likely the VAE aka variational autoencoder. It decodes the image from latent space into the output that is then shown to us. Sometimes it has a hard time translating the latent space representation of the image resulting in artifacts like this.

is it possible to make dall-e give a reason right when an answer is flagged as content policy violation? I just don't want to do another query towards my cap asking why there was a problem
in short, chatGPT doesn't know why a generation gets rejected. it only know if it's due to an error or if it's due to "content policy violation". It doesn't receive the reason, just the info from DALL-E that it was unable to generate the image
So it's useless to ask it for more info
yes, but if you do a follow-up question, what was wrong? then there's a plausible info that can help pin out the problem, to the expense of a new prompt
It's chatGPT hallucinating a reason
unfortunately... I wish it was more transparent
DALL·E returned no images. Don't repeat the descriptions in detail.The user's requests didn't follow our content policy. Before doing anything else, please explicitly explain to the user that you were unable to generate images because of this. Make sure to use the phrase \"content policy\" in your response. DO NOT UNDER ANY CIRCUMSTANCES retry generating images until a new request is given."
dall-e says that to gpt-4. then everything else is hallucination based on its knowledge of the content policy

dall-e 3, from my understanding, is mostly about synthetic image captions (+ scaling)

Must have cost a bundle to run the training set through Vision API
right... it's a bit annoying how people forget and tend to accept "standards" as the ultimate truth.
Luckily it worked lmao
well it's got a lot of similarities to other previous image generation models. main difference is the synthetic training data
from my understanding, it's the same architecture as previous dall-e models. but there's a new .. how they call it, caption decoder or something like that. (also, implicit but obvious: dall-e 3 is a larger model. it also supports longer prompts)
